Lines Matching defs:cur_arg
151 const char* cur_arg = argv[argi];
152 if ('-' == cur_arg[0] && !only_positional_arguments_remain) {
153 if (0 == strcmp(cur_arg, "--version")) {
157 } else if (0 == strcmp(cur_arg, "--help") || 0 == strcmp(cur_arg, "-h")) {
160 } else if (0 == strcmp(cur_arg, "-o")) {
167 } else if (0 == strncmp(cur_arg,
169 const auto split_flag = spvtools::utils::SplitFlagArgs(cur_arg);
176 } else if (0 == strncmp(cur_arg, "--target-function=",
178 const auto split_flag = spvtools::utils::SplitFlagArgs(cur_arg);
185 } else if (0 == strcmp(cur_arg, "--fail-on-validation-error")) {
187 } else if (0 == strcmp(cur_arg, "--before-hlsl-legalization")) {
189 } else if (0 == strcmp(cur_arg, "--relax-logical-pointer")) {
191 } else if (0 == strcmp(cur_arg, "--relax-block-layout")) {
193 } else if (0 == strcmp(cur_arg, "--scalar-block-layout")) {
195 } else if (0 == strcmp(cur_arg, "--skip-block-layout")) {
197 } else if (0 == strcmp(cur_arg, "--relax-struct-store")) {
199 } else if (0 == strncmp(cur_arg, "--temp-file-prefix=",
201 const auto split_flag = spvtools::utils::SplitFlagArgs(cur_arg);
203 } else if (0 == strcmp(cur_arg, "--")) {
207 ss << "Unrecognized argument: " << cur_arg << std::endl;
215 *in_binary_file = std::string(cur_arg);
218 interestingness_test->push_back(std::string(cur_arg));